How to Reset the Service Airbag Light on Silverado? Quick Fix!

To reset the Service Airbag Light on a Silverado, turn the ignition on and off without starting the engine three times. Check the instrument cluster to see if the light has been reset.

Resetting the Service Airbag Light on your Silverado is an important step in maintaining your vehicle’s safety features.

The presence of this warning light often indicates that your airbag system needs attention. Before you attempt to reset the light, make sure to address any issues that may have triggered the warning.

This can range from checking for loose connections to ensuring the airbags are functioning properly. Regular maintenance is crucial for the airbag system, which plays an integral role in protecting occupants during a collision.

Understanding the steps to reset the light can save you a trip to the mechanic, provided the system has no underlying faults. Always refer to the owner’s manual for specific guidance tailored to your Silverado model.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I Reset My Silverado Airbag Light At Home?

Yes, you can reset the airbag light on your Silverado at home. However, ensure the issue prompting the light is resolved first to avoid safety risks.

What Steps Are Involved In Resetting A Silverado Airbag Light?

To reset a Silverado airbag light, you’ll typically need to turn the ignition on and off, check for trouble codes, clear them with a scanner, and then confirm the light is off.

Is A Special Tool Required For Resetting The Airbag Light?

Yes, a diagnostic scan tool is necessary to reset the Silverado airbag light. It reads and clears codes that trigger the airbag warning.

How Do I Know If My Silverado Airbag System Is Working Properly?

After resetting, if the airbag light turns off and stays off, your Silverado airbag system is likely operating correctly. Regular system checks are advised for safety.
